Chulmleigh is a small Saxon hilltop market town and civil parish located in North Devon in the heart of the English county of Devon. It is located 20 miles (32 km) north west of Exeter, just north of the Mid Devon boundary, linked by the A377 and B3096 roads. See more The first documentary reference to the place is in the Domesday Book of 1086 where it is recorded as Calmonlevge. Reduced today Marketed by EweMove Sales & Lettings - … WebChumley Name Meaning English (Middlesex and Surrey): habitational name from Cholmondeley in Cheshire named from the Old English personal name Cēolmund + lēah ‘woodland clearing’. The spelling of the surname reflects the current pronunciation of the placename.
